Ordinals
beta
Address bc1qx2l30kq03u95fjgn2uprpsdxfgjksnxjuv2ujz
sat balance
293733
outputs
0f70850c459267f87d3df0fd037468e35900f68bb6e3e9c6c30d8641c56d436e:722